Updated: Drama Unfolds as Emefiele Eludes Cameras During Court Appearance

In a compelling turn of events, Godwin Emefiele, the suspended governor of the Central Bank of Nigeria (CBN), adeptly avoided the scrutiny of cameras as he made his entrance at the Federal Capital Territory (FCT) High Court on Thursday.

Having remained in the custody of the Department of State Services (DSS) since his arrest subsequent to his suspension by President Bola Tinubu on June 9th, Emefiele engaged in courteous exchanges with his legal team within the court premises.

As the operatives of the secretive law enforcement agency ushered him into the courtroom, the press corps found themselves restricted from freely capturing photographs of the defendant, who was also effectively shielded by his legal representatives.
